In today's demanding industrial landscape, maximizing equipment performance while minimizing downtime is paramount. Periodic lube oil analysis provides invaluable insights into the health of critical machinery components. By examining lubricant samples for a range of contaminants, technicians can pinpoint potential problems before they lead to costly repairs or severe breakdowns. This predictive approach allows businesses to improve equipment lifespan, decrease maintenance costs, and ensure smooth operational productivity.
- Utilizing lube oil analysis programs involves a thorough process that encompasses sample collection, laboratory testing, interpretation of results, and the development of customized maintenance plans.
- Essential parameters often monitored in lube oil analysis include viscosity index, base number, wear metal content, impurity concentrations, and additive depletion. These measurements offer indications into the comprehensive condition of the lubricant and the machinery it serves.

Lubricant Testing Services: Identifying Potential Issues Before They Become Problems
Proactive maintenance are crucial in ensuring the continued performance of machinery and equipment. Lubricants play a vital role in this process, reducing friction, stopping wear and tear, and improving overall efficiency. However, lubricants are not static entities. They degrade over time due to factors like temperature, pressure, contamination, and usage patterns. This degradation can lead to a range of problems, from increased friction and heat generation to premature component failure.
Lubricant testing services provide a valuable tool for identifying potential issues before they escalate into major problems. By analyzing the physical and chemical properties of lubricants at regular intervals, these services can detect early signs of degradation, allowing for timely intervention and maintenance. This proactive approach not only extends the life of equipment but also minimizes downtime, reduces repair costs, and guarantees safe and efficient operation.
- A comprehensive lubricant testing service typically includes a range of analyses, such as viscosity, flash point, pour point, acid number, base number, wear metal content, and contaminant analysis.
- Furthermore, specialized tests may be performed to assess specific properties relevant to the application, such as oxidation stability, thermal stability, and anti-wear performance.

Expert Lube Oil Analysis: Keeping Your Operations Running Smoothly
Regular oil analysis is an essential part of maintaining your machinery's performance. By analyzing the condition of your fluids, you can pinpoint potential concerns early on and minimize costly downtime. Skilled analysts can provide valuable insights about the degradation of your assets, allowing you to make strategic decisions regarding maintenance and replacement.
A comprehensive examination can expose a wide range of indicators, including contamination levels, wear particles, viscosity changes, and additive depletion. This information allows you to enhance your lubrication program, extending the life of your assets and minimizing operating expenses.
